Al Ḩawātah weather in March

In March, Al Ḩawātah sees average daytime highs of 40°C and overnight lows near 25°C, with 1 mm of rain across 0.2 wet days and about 11.9 hours of daylight. It is the 3rd-warmest and 8th-wettest month of the year here.

Highs climb over the month, from about 39°C in the first days to 41°C by the end.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 79% of the time in March, and the air most often feels dry.

Daylight stretches from about 11 h 42 min at the start of March to 12 h 06 min by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, March is Al Ḩawātah's 4th-clearest and 2nd-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see Al Ḩawātah's year-round climate.

Temperature in March

Average highAverage lowShaded bands: 10–90% of days

Highs climb over the month, from about 39°C in the first days to 41°C by the end.

A typical March day in Al Ḩawātah reaches about 40°C in the afternoon and slips back to 25°C overnight — a 15°C spread between the day's warmth and the night's chill. On most days the high lands between 37°C and 43°C. Set against its neighbours, March runs about 3°C warmer than February and about 2°C cooler than April.

Air quality in Al Ḩawātah in March

GoodModeratePoorUnhealthyVery unhealthy

Average fine-particle pollution (PM2.5) through the year — so you can see where March falls, not just the annual average.

Air quality in Al Ḩawātah is worst in March — around 34 µg/m³ PM2.5 (moderate), about 2.2× the cleanest month (November, 16 µg/m³).

Modeled monthly averages (CAMS reanalysis, 2015–2024).

Location & terrain

Where is Al Ḩawātah?

Al Ḩawātah sits at 13.4°N, 34.6°E, 445 m above sea level, in Sudan. The nearest listed city is Ad-Dindar, 59 km away.

MaiurnoAl QadarifSennar

Topography around Al Ḩawātah

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of Al Ḩawātah.

Within 3 km, the terrain around Al Ḩawātah has only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 12 m around an average of 442 m above sea level; within 16 km, only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 32 m; within 80 km, signific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 343 m.

The land around Al Ḩawātah is covered by cropland (55%) and grassland (29%) within 3 km, cropland (81%) within 16 km, and cropland (79%) within 80 km.
